Pertanyaan yang diberi tag «dto»


1
Apa gunanya DTO daripada Entity?
Saya sedang mengerjakan aplikasi RCP, saya baru di aplikasi ini. Spring bean digunakan untuk menulis logika bisnis untuk menyelamatkan / mengambil entitas. Namun, alih-alih mengirim entitas langsung ke klien, kami mengonversi ke DTO dan menambah klien. Saat menyimpan, kami kembali mengonversi DTO ke entitas dan menyimpan. Apa manfaat dari konversi …
18 java  spring  entity  map  dto 

3
Berbagi objek DTO antara layanan microser
TL; DR - Apakah boleh berbagi perpustakaan POJO antar layanan? Secara umum, kami ingin menjaga agar pembagian antar layanan sangat terbatas jika tidak ada. Ada beberapa perdebatan apakah layanan yang membagikan data harus menyediakan pustaka klien untuk digunakan klien. Client-lib umumnya opsional untuk klien dari layanan yang akan digunakan dan …

4
Gunakan komposisi dan warisan untuk DTO
Kami memiliki ASP.NET Web API yang menyediakan REST API untuk Aplikasi Satu Halaman kami. Kami menggunakan DTO / POCO untuk meneruskan data melalui API ini. Masalahnya sekarang, bahwa DTO ini semakin besar dari waktu ke waktu, jadi sekarang kami ingin memperbaiki DTO. Saya mencari "praktik terbaik" bagaimana merancang DTO: Saat …
13 rest  api-design  web-api  dto  poco 

2
Arsitektur Bersih: Apa Model Tampilan?
Dalam bukunya 'Clean Architecture', Paman Bob mengatakan bahwa Presenter harus memasukkan data yang diterimanya ke dalam sesuatu yang dia sebut 'View Model'. Apakah ini sama dengan 'ViewModel' dari pola desain Model-View-ViewModel (MVVM) atau apakah itu Data Transfer Object (DTO) yang sederhana? Jika ini bukan DTO sederhana, bagaimana hubungannya dengan View? …

6
Apakah memisahkan sebagian besar kelas menjadi hanya bidang data dan hanya kelas metode (jika mungkin) yang baik atau anti-pola?
Sebagai contoh, suatu kelas biasanya memiliki anggota dan metode kelas, misalnya: public class Cat{ private String name; private int weight; private Image image; public void printInfo(){ System.out.println("Name:"+this.name+",weight:"+this.weight); } public void draw(){ //some draw code which uses this.image } } Tetapi setelah membaca tentang prinsip tanggung jawab tunggal dan prinsip tertutup …
Dengan menggunakan situs kami, Anda mengakui telah membaca dan memahami Kebijakan Cookie dan Kebijakan Privasi kami.
Licensed under cc by-sa 3.0 with attribution required.